ABOUT THE COMPANY Oceania Ground Force, an Australian-owned Ground Handling Services Company, is dedicated to delivering professional and efficient services to leading airlines. Operating since June 1996, we have grown to over 500 employees in 14 locations across Australia and the Pacific. Our company combines cutting-edge technology and equipment with a hands-on management approach to ensure top-notch service quality. ABOUT THE ROLE This is an exciting opportunity to be part of the frontline team ensuring the safety and efficiency of aircraft operations. Your role involves handling critical tasks such as bagroom operations, loading and unloading, operating specialised equipment, and ensuring the precise receipting and dispatching of aircraft. Every day offers a new challenge and a chance to make a real impact. YOUR DUTIES Perform bagroom functions, including scanning and manual handling of luggage. Load and unload baggage and freight efficiently. Manage aircraft receipt and dispatch procedures. Execute aircraft pushback operations safely. Provide essential water and waste services.
